Anthropic’s Claude AI is now available on Apple CarPlay, allowing drivers to interact with a general-purpose chatbot via voice on their vehicle’s display. This development signals a shift toward AI assistants becoming a standard feature in cars, expanding beyond navigation and media.
Anthropic has introduced its Claude AI assistant to Apple CarPlay, enabling users to access a conversational AI directly from their vehicle’s dashboard, as detailed in the original analysis from MacRumors. This marks the first time a general-purpose AI chatbot is available in this environment, extending AI interaction beyond phones and desktops into the car for both drivers and passengers. The integration occurs via an update to the Claude iOS app, which now supports CarPlay as an interface. Apple’s CarPlay system mirrors approved apps from an iPhone onto the vehicle’s display, traditionally limited to navigation, audio, messaging, and productivity apps. The inclusion of Claude suggests that AI chatbots are being considered as a new app category for in-car use, emphasizing voice interaction for safety and convenience. According to the report, the primary mode of interaction is voice-based, allowing users to converse with Claude hands-free while driving. However, details about the full scope of features—such as whether the app supports visual responses, file access, or limited functionalities—are not yet confirmed. Background on AI Integration in Vehicles
Apple’s CarPlay has evolved from a simple mirroring interface for maps and calls to a platform supporting a broad range of apps, including audio, messaging, and productivity tools. The platform’s expansion reflects Apple’s broader interest in integrating AI into its ecosystem, with recent reports hinting at deeper AI features within iOS and other software updates.
Anthropic’s Claude has gained prominence as a general-purpose AI assistant, competing with OpenAI’s ChatGPT and Google’s Gemini. The company has expanded Claude across multiple platforms, including iOS, Android, and enterprise settings. The recent update to the Claude iOS app, adding CarPlay support, aligns with this broader strategy of embedding AI into everyday devices and environments.
Until now, AI assistants have primarily been confined to phones, desktops, and smart speakers. The move into automotive dashboards marks a new frontier, driven by the increasing demand for hands-free, voice-controlled AI interactions during long drives and commutes.
Unconfirmed Details About CarPlay AI Features
Many specifics about the Claude CarPlay integration remain unverified. It is unclear which features are available—whether the app supports full conversations, visual responses, or limited voice commands. The requirements for subscription tiers, geographic availability, and whether Apple approved AI chatbots as a category on CarPlay are also unknown. Additionally, how the app manages safety, such as interaction limits when the vehicle is moving, has not been publicly detailed.
